Appropriate Preposition:

  • Annoyed with ( বিরক্ত (ব্যক্তি) ) I was annoyed with him for being late.
  • Certain of ( নিশ্চিত ) He is now certain of his ground.
  • Smile on ( অনুগ্রহ করা ) Fortune smiled on him.
  • Inquire about ( অনুসন্ধান করা (কোন ব্যপার) ) I inquired of him about (into) the matter.
  • Familiar with ( সুপরিচিত ) He is familiar with my brother.
  • Pretend to ( ভান করা ) He does not pretend to high birth.

Idioms:

  • pulling your leg ( কৌতক করা ) Do not take it seriously, i was just pulling you leg
  • By leaps and bounds ( অতি দ্রুতগতিতে ) The population of Bangladesh is increasing by leaps and bounds.
  • Hue and cry ( শোরগোল ) The villagers raised a hue and cry to see the thief.
  • On the spur of the moment ( মুহুর্তের উত্তেজনায় ) He did it on the spur of the moment.
  • At all ( আদৌ ) He does not know French at all.
  • At arm’s length ( দূরে ) Try to keep the bad boy at arm’s length.
